Typicality Effect Vs Familiarity Effect

In cognitive psychology and linguistics, the concepts of the typicality effect and the familiarity effect help explain how people process and categorize information in their minds. These effects influence how we recognize, recall, and make judgments about objects, words, or experiences. Although both are related to memory and perception, they stem from different mechanisms. Understanding the distinction between the typicality effect vs familiarity effect provides valuable insight into how our brains organize concepts and why certain items or ideas feel more normal or known than others.

Understanding the Typicality Effect

The typicality effect refers to the phenomenon in which people respond faster and more accurately to items that are more typical or representative of a given category. In other words, when we think of a category, such as bird, we are more likely to picture a robin or sparrow than a penguin or ostrich. This happens because typical items share more features with the prototype the mental average of that category.

Psychologists studying categorization have found that the typicality effect plays a crucial role in how people classify and retrieve information. Items that are typical members of a category are more easily identified and remembered. For example, when asked whether an apple is a fruit, people respond more quickly than when asked whether an olive is a fruit, even though both are technically correct.

Causes of the Typicality Effect

Several factors contribute to the typicality effect

  • Prototype theoryCategories are organized around mental prototypes that represent the average member of a group. The closer an item is to this prototype, the more typical it feels.
  • Feature overlapTypical items share many common features with other category members, which makes them easier to recognize.
  • Frequency of exposureThe more often we encounter certain examples, the more strongly they reinforce the mental image of a category.

This effect helps explain why people can make quick decisions in daily life. When something looks, behaves, or feels typical, it fits neatly into our mental framework, allowing for rapid recognition without deep analysis.

Examples of the Typicality Effect

Common examples can be found in everyday thinking. For instance

  • When asked to name a color, most people say red, blue, or green rather than turquoise.
  • When thinking of a mammal, dog or cat comes to mind faster than platypus.
  • In social psychology, certain stereotypes function similarly people quickly identify individuals who fit expected group traits.

These examples show that the typicality effect shapes how we process categories across many areas of thought, from language to perception to cultural assumptions.

Understanding the Familiarity Effect

The familiarity effect, sometimes referred to as the mere exposure effect, describes how people tend to prefer or recognize things that they have encountered before. This effect suggests that repeated exposure increases liking, recognition, and comfort with an object, word, or idea even when there is no logical reason for the preference.

In memory and cognitive psychology, the familiarity effect helps explain why we find certain faces, songs, or brands more appealing. The more we encounter something, the more familiar it feels, and the easier it is for our brain to process. This psychological ease often translates into positive feelings, leading to biases in decision-making and judgment.

Causes of the Familiarity Effect

The familiarity effect occurs because of how the brain processes repeated information. When we see or hear something multiple times, our neural pathways become more efficient at recognizing it. This sense of fluency creates a positive emotional response. Key contributing factors include

  • Repeated exposureThe more we experience something, the more our brain associates it with safety and comfort.
  • Processing fluencyFamiliar items require less cognitive effort to recognize, leading to a subconscious preference.
  • Emotional connectionFamiliar things can evoke a sense of nostalgia or trust, reinforcing their appeal.

This is why advertisers often repeat the same slogans or logos familiarity breeds acceptance and preference, even without logical evaluation.

Examples of the Familiarity Effect

Examples of the familiarity effect are abundant in both daily life and scientific research

  • People are more likely to enjoy a song after hearing it several times, even if they did not like it initially.
  • Voters tend to favor political candidates whose names they recognize.
  • Consumers are drawn to brands they have seen frequently, even when competitors offer better value.

In essence, familiarity acts as a mental shortcut our brains associate repeated exposure with safety, reliability, and trustworthiness.

Comparing Typicality Effect vs Familiarity Effect

While the typicality effect and familiarity effect may seem similar because both influence recognition and decision-making, they stem from different cognitive processes. The typicality effect is about how well something represents a category, while the familiarity effect is about how often something has been encountered.

The typicality effect deals with internal categorization. It focuses on how mental prototypes shape our understanding of categories. Familiarity, on the other hand, involves memory and exposure our feelings toward something increase with repeated experience, regardless of whether it fits a category well.

Key Differences Between the Two Effects

  • Basis of recognitionTypicality depends on category structure, while familiarity depends on prior exposure.
  • Speed vs. preferenceTypicality enhances the speed and accuracy of classification, while familiarity influences preference and liking.
  • Novelty responseHighly familiar items may lose novelty appeal, whereas typical items remain useful for quick categorization.
  • Neural processingTypicality engages semantic networks and prototype representations, while familiarity activates recognition and emotional memory systems.

Despite these differences, both effects often work together in human cognition. For instance, something typical of a category is often also familiar because of frequent exposure. Conversely, a familiar but atypical object like a penguin for the category bird can cause momentary hesitation because it conflicts with our prototype expectations.

Applications in Everyday Life

Understanding the typicality effect vs familiarity effect has practical applications across multiple domains, from marketing to education to artificial intelligence. In marketing, companies use familiarity to build brand loyalty through repeated exposure, while typicality is used to design products that align with consumer expectations. For example, a typical smartphone design feels intuitive, while the repeated visibility of a brand name enhances consumer trust.

In education, teachers can use typical examples when introducing new concepts, helping students grasp categories quickly. As students gain familiarity with a topic through repetition, learning becomes easier and more efficient. In cognitive science and machine learning, these effects help researchers design better models for human-like categorization and decision-making.

Interplay Between Typicality and Familiarity

Although distinct, the two effects often interact in subtle ways. Familiarity can enhance the perception of typicality because repeated exposure reinforces our mental prototypes. At the same time, typicality can make items feel more familiar because they fit expected patterns. This interplay helps explain why we find comfort in things that make sense and why our preferences often align with what we already know.

However, the balance between these effects can vary across contexts. In creative industries, for example, familiarity might be less valued than novelty, while in safety-critical settings, typicality is crucial for quick recognition and action. Recognizing how these mental processes operate allows individuals and organizations to make better decisions, from designing learning materials to predicting consumer behavior.
